ホームページ  >  記事  >  CPU 制御バスは何を提供しますか?

CPU 制御バスは何を提供しますか?

尚
オリジナル
2019-12-11 10:55:248351ブラウズ

CPU 制御バスは何を提供しますか?

コントロール バス (ControlBus) は CB と呼ばれます。制御バスは主に制御信号やタイミング信号の伝送に使用されます。 制御信号の中には、読み出し/書き込み信号、チップ選択信号、割り込み応答信号など、マイクロプロセッサによってメモリおよび入出力デバイスのインターフェイス回路に送信されるものと、プロセッサにフィードバックされるものがあります。 CPU による他のコンポーネント(割り込み、アプリケーション信号、リセット信号、バス要求信号、デバイスレディ信号など)

したがって、制御バスの送信方向は特定の制御信号によって決定され、通常は双方向であり、制御バスのビット数はシステムの実際の制御ニーズに応じて決定されます。実際、制御バスの具体的な状況は主に CPU に依存します。

制御バスは相互に接続され、それらの間の通信とデータ伝送を完了および実装します。したがって、バスの概念は、PC とマザーボードのコンポーネント間の構造、動作原理、および相互関係を理解するための基礎となります。

これらの制御情報には、メモリおよび入出力インターフェイスに対する CPU の読み取りおよび書き込み信号、入出力インターフェイスによって CPU に送出される割り込み要求または DMA 要求信号、CPU の応答およびこれらの入出力インターフェイスへの応答信号、入出力インターフェイスからのさまざまな動作ステータス信号、およびその他のさまざまな機能制御信号。制御バスは、CPU、メモリ、入出力デバイスの間を移動します。

この記事は、FAQ 列から引用したものです。

以上がCPU 制御バスは何を提供します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。